Notes
Recorded at Atlantic Recording Studios, New York, New York.
Vocal arrangements by Bernard Kafka.
Bernard Kafka Singers (B.K. Singers): Laura Tequila Logan, Ann Tripp, Bill Ruthenberg and Bernard Kafka
All compositions published by LATO Music, ASCAP, except 'Horsing Around' which is published by LATO Music / Norman J. Simon Music Co., ASCAP.

I have a vast collection already but you can never have enough quality tunes. - One of the Grooviest pieces of Jazz & Funk I've ever had the privilege of hanging on to for all these years. Moog & Synth with sexy vocals from Urszula Dudziak. Top notch musicians & creative input on this one. It's been sampled by DJ's & Producers but most recognized (in my opinion) are the samples from "Rien Ne Va Plus" used on "Car Thief" from The beastie Boys' Pauls Boutique LP from 1989. A very space-aged trippy voyage of Jazz funk & soul
